Well, I got it. Yesterday was a little rough but the liquid Lortab took the edge off. Today I'm feeling much better and as promised, I'm not hungry which is a good thing since I'm clear liquids for a few more days followed full liquids, then soft foods, etc. The worst part has been crushing up my HBP medication so I could take it. Disgusting. :laugh: Hopefully, I won't need it too much longer. :thumbdown:

The doc said my liver was a bit big which I don't understand since I thought I followed his instructions to the letter. I guess I was doing something wrong though. Oh well, it wasn't bad enough for him to pull out luckily.
